Qualification Requirements
Maruti Suzuki emphasizes strong academic and technical qualifications for candidates:
| Post Name | Qualification |
|---|---|
| Graduate Engineer Trainee | B.E/B.Tech in Mechanical, Electrical, Electronics, Automobile, or related fields |
| Technician Trainee | Diploma in Engineering (Mechanical, Electrical, or relevant branches) |
| Design Engineer | B.E/B.Tech in Mechanical/Automobile/Design Engineering |
| Production Engineer | B.E/B.Tech in Mechanical/Production/Automobile Engineering |
| Software Engineer | B.Tech/M.Tech in Computer Science, IT, or related field |
| HR Executive | Graduate/Postgraduate in HR Management or MBA(HR) |
| Sales Executive | Graduate in any discipline with strong communication skills |
| Finance Analyst | Graduate/Postgraduate in Finance, Accounting, or CA/ICWA |
| Manager / Assistant Manager | MBA/B.Tech with 3–5 years relevant experience |
| Business Development Manager | MBA/PGDM in Marketing or Business Administration |
Age Limit: Typically between 21–35 years, with some flexibility depending on experience and the position.

Selection Process
Maruti Suzuki follows a structured recruitment process to select the most suitable candidates:
- Application Screening: Shortlisting candidates based on eligibility, qualifications, and experience.
- Written/Online Test: For technical and managerial roles, evaluating aptitude, technical knowledge, and problem-solving abilities.
- Technical Interview: Assessing domain expertise, analytical skills, and practical knowledge.
- HR Interview: Evaluating behavioral skills, communication, and cultural fit.
- Medical Examination: Ensuring candidates meet health and fitness standards.
- Offer Letter: Successful candidates receive an official offer detailing salary and joining instructions.
Note: Direct interviews may be conducted for specific sales, technician, or trainee roles.
